Key Insights of Japan Home Use ECG Monitor Market
-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$350 million, driven by rising cardiovascular health awareness and technological adoption among consumers.
-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ach $620 million, reflecting a CAGR of around 17% over the next three years.
- Leading Segment: Consumer-grade portable ECG devices dominate, accounting for over 65% of sales, with wearable patches gaining rapid traction.
- Core Application: Remote health monitoring for arrhythmia detection and chronic disease management remains the primary use case, supported by telehealth integration.
- Leading Geography: Urban centers such as Tokyo and Osaka hold over 70% market share due to higher disposable incomes and healthcare infrastructure.
- Key Market Opportunity: Integration of AI-driven diagnostics and user-friendly interfaces presents significant growth potential, especially in aging demographics.
- Major Companies: Leading players include Nihon Kohden, Omron Healthcare, and startups like AliveCor Japan, competing on innovation and distribution channels.
Market Dynamics and Strategic Trends in Japan Home Use ECG Monitoring
The Japanese market for home use ECG devices is characterized by a convergence of technological innovation, demographic shifts, and evolving healthcare policies. The country’s aging population—over 28% aged 65 or older—creates a persistent demand for accessible, reliable cardiac monitoring solutions that enable early detection and ongoing management of cardiovascular conditions. This demographic trend fuels consumer willingness to adopt user-friendly, compact devices that seamlessly integrate with telemedicine platforms.
Technological advancements such as AI-powered analysis, Bluetooth connectivity, and cloud-based data sharing are transforming traditional ECG devices into sophisticated health management tools. Companies are investing heavily in R&D to develop devices that combine accuracy with ease of use, catering to a broad spectrum of consumers from tech-savvy seniors to health-conscious younger populations. Regulatory frameworks in Japan favor innovation, providing pathways for rapid approval of digital health solutions, which further accelerates market growth. Strategic partnerships between device manufacturers, healthcare providers, and insurance companies are becoming commonplace, fostering a more integrated ecosystem that enhances patient engagement and data-driven decision-making.

Impact of Regulatory Environment and Policy Frameworks on Market Development
Japan’s regulatory landscape for digital health devices is evolving to support innovation while ensuring safety and efficacy. The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ices Agency (PMDA) has streamlined approval pathways for wearable and digital health solutions, encouraging startups and established firms to accelerate product launches. Recent amendments to the Pharmaceutical and Medical Device Act facilitate faster clearance for AI-enabled diagnostic tools, fostering a conducive environment for innovation.
Government initiatives such as the Society 5.0 strategy emphasize integrating digital technologies into healthcare, promoting telehealth, and remote monitoring. These policies incentivize the adoption of home use ECG devices, especially through reimbursement schemes and public health campaigns targeting cardiovascular health. However, challenges remain around data privacy, standardization, and interoperability, which require ongoing regulatory refinement. Companies that proactively align with these policies and contribute to setting industry standards will benefit from early market access and increased consumer trust.
